    ●e-Net Caravan

    Photo taken at an e-Net Caravan seminar

    By offering seminars to children, the company is taking its social responsibility to rise the awareness to the safe and secure use of internet.

    The action to promote the safe and secure use of the internet and smartphones to students as well as guardians and teachers.

    The number of certified instructors 456instructors (As of end of Sept 2019)

    The number of seminars

    done 128seminars (As of end of Sept 2019)● Environmental initiatives: Installing the solar panels and power generating systems to directly managed shops by T-Gaia and its warehouses.

    The Midterm GoalsFrom November 2015, T-Gaia has set a medium-term goals to realize a sustainable growth and to respond to the expectations of all stakeholders including shareholders and employees by achieving the following objectives based on the corporate philosophy toward the FY 2020 (FY ending March 2021).

    ● Firmly maintain the position as the leading company in the core business of mobile phone distribution ● Grow solution business for corporate clients, settlement service and overseas business as a strong core business● Create and explore new business opportunities in the mobile and internet industries● Maintain the dividend payout ratio over 30%

    In order to realize the objectives noted above, T-Gaia is taking concrete measures every day, setting the following points as the company-wide strategy.

    ● Cultivate, recruit, utilize and retain human resources to realize maximization and optimization of achievement of respective employees● Conduct strategic and continuous cost managements to transform the cost structure into one that can response to the change of the market environment● Maximize the corporate-wide achievements by optimizing the organization as well as the corporate system

    Based on the above medium-term goals and company-wide strategies, T-Gaia will develop the business strategies for each business lines and make every effort to realize them through the concrete action plans in each business departments.

    The wide spread of smartphones allows people to connect to the world regardless of time. It has brought huge changes to the way people communicate, gather information and purchase.New types of businesses and services that were unimaginable in the past are now available. The market became more competitive and so as the chance of forming a new partnership.

    Evaluations on the Business Environment

    T-Gaia will accelerate the speed to become “a Comprehensive Provider of ICT-Related Domains”.The company will accelerate its investments in its digital services while making full use of its analog strengths, such as shops and sales bases across the nation, the diverse range of business models and well-established trades.It will strive to develop new businesses and services while maintaining the existing partnership within the group.

    Strategies of T-Gaia
